Replace a remote control key

If you've lost your remote control keys for your Ford Focus, you'll probably be wondering how to replace it. It's easy. Simply replace the battery in your key fob. The battery used in key fobs is a CR2032 coin cell.

Replace an ignition cylinder

You may need to replace the ignition cylinder on your Ford Focus is having trouble starting. The entire cylinder which connects to the starter motor is called the ignition cylinder. It's located in the steering column. In order to replace this component you have to take off the steering column upper cover and remove the dashboard panel.

The replacement of the cylinder that controls the ignition costs between $199 and $247, not including tax or location. The price is based on the type of cylinder you require and the number of Ford Focuses that are on the road. The cylinder is an essential part of the ignition system, because it's one of the vehicles' defenses against theft.
